Cookie
Web cookies can be defined as small text strings that the sites visited by the user send to his terminal (typically the browser), where they are stored before being re-transmitted to the same sites at the next visit by the same user. The site contains cookies and / or other similar IT tools listed below. You can accept, reject or change your preferences regarding the installation of cookies through the appropriate banner / icon that appears on the homepage or through the preferences of the browser used. By modifying the parameters relating to cookies, limitations may occur in the visualization or functions offered by this site.
